Bridge over Kwanza River in Angola concluded in March, 2010

17 December 2009

Luanda, Angola, 17 Dec – The bridge over the River Kwanza, in Cangadala municipality, in Angola’s Malanje province, which is 308 metres long, will be opened to traffic in the first quarter of 2010, said Ricardo Guimarães, director of the Portuguese contractor, Conduril – Construtora Duriense that is carrying out the work.

The bridge, which has been undergoing refurbishment since January 2008, will have two 3.5 metre-wide lanes.

Refurbishment work on the bridge is estimated to cost US$31.8 million.

Guimarães also said that the bridge over the River Kwanza is one of the most advanced in Angola and the world in terms of its engineering.

The bridge over the River Kwanza provides access to the provinces of Bié, Kwanza Sul and Huambo. (macauhub)
